The Barna Group - Millions of Unchurched Adults Are Christians Hurt by Churches But Can Be Healed of the Pain - George Bullard's Posterous

Here is an article by George Bullard reflecting on research done by the Barna group about the 100 million or so self-identified Christians who have opted out of church. A large portion of them blame church conflict and the pain they received while being part of a local church. Perhaps we as leaders need to return to Paul's letters to the Corinthians and read them as though they were meant for us.

Also, we continuously have compromised our values. We have spoken values (what we say is important) and lived values (what we act like is important). Of course our lived values speak so loudly and so much more clearly, that our spoken values are drowned out.

What can your church (and my church) do to re-build bridges with believers to help them get back on the road to discipleship?
